>You've done a man's job, sir
A person of average or higher intelligence realizes that Gaff's line is ironic. Deckard's job is dehumanizing and has left him traumatized and emotionally void. It's the least subtle cherry top on top of the movie's themes, that Deckard has made himself inhuman and now learned humanity again from the Replicants' struggle to live.

That was exactly what it was. In the original cut, Deckard goes to visit his friend Holden in the hospital. They talk about the new replicants and how scary good they are now. They are used to the shitty models of replicants that are easy to spot and basically retarded. They're obviously not humans, barely above animals, and most would not have much empathy for them. It's only the Nexus 6 and Rachel that have improved so far they are almost passing the VK machine. That's what finally breaks Deckard that he empathizes with their plight, stops viewing them as "IT"s and as human instead, and becomes determined to enjoy his own life again after seeing how much they had a true desire to live.
